Caiao a tutti ho letto già un bel pò di post riguardo l'argomento ma non mi sono stati molto d'aiuto.

Allora io ho bisogno di creare un datagrid con dei dati e un checkbox. Il checkbox mi servere per rendere visibile o invisibile poi latoclient il record.

Ora Prima di tutto creo il datagrid:

<aspataGrid ID="Esp_vis" runat="server" DataKeyField="id_esperienza" AutoGenerateColumns="false">
<columns>
<asp:BoundColumn headertext="Ente" DataField="ente"></asp:BoundColumn>
<asp:BoundColumn headertext="Professione" DataField="professione"></asp:BoundColumn>
<asp:BoundColumn headertext="Ruolo" DataField="ruolo"></asp:BoundColumn>
<asp:TemplateColumn headertext="Nascondi">
<itemtemplate>
<asp:checkbox runat="server" id="cbnascondi" />
</itemtemplate>
</asp:TemplateColumn>
</columns>
</aspataGrid>


<asp:Label ID="messaggio" runat="server"></asp:Label>



<asp:Button ID="Button1" runat="server" Text="Salva" /></div>

La prima domanda è come faccio quando carico il datagrid a far capire quale checkbox deve essere selezionato e quale no non avendo un DataField?

Poi seocnda domanda al click di Button1 come faccio a modificare i vari record nel Db con i valori selezionati e non?

Grazie a tutti.